A Cosmic Nursery Revealed:
Imagine a stellar nursery, where stars are born and grow, shrouded in mystery and cosmic dust. That's LDN 1641, a dark nebula located a staggering 1,300 light-years away from our planet. It's a place where young stars are forming, hidden from our view. But the Euclid telescope has managed to peer through this veil, capturing an image that is truly out of this world.
And here's where it gets fascinating: the telescope didn't just snap a photo. The Euclid team, in a stroke of genius, used this dark nebula for a critical purpose—telescope calibration. With no bright stars to guide them, the team had to rely on the nebula's unique characteristics, making it the perfect testing ground for the telescope's pointing system. And it worked! In a mere five hours, Euclid captured an image three times the size of the full moon, showcasing its remarkable capabilities.

Unveiling the Universe's Secrets:
With its calibration success, Euclid is now ready for its grand cosmic survey. This survey aims to answer some of the deepest mysteries of the cosmos, including the enigmatic dark energy and the evolution of galaxies. By capturing detailed images of distant regions, Euclid will provide scientists with invaluable data to unravel the universe's history and structure.
